  • Healthcare and Information Management Systems Society (HIMSS), Chicago, IL, founded in 1961, is a not-for-profit organization dedicated to promoting a better understanding of health care information and management systems. HIMSS represents over 6,000 health care professionals in four professional areas: Clinical systems, Information systems, Management engineering, Telecommunications.
